Bardejov weather in March

In March, Bardejov sees average daytime highs of 7°C and overnight lows near -1°C, with 43 mm of precipitation across 10.5 wet days and about 11.5 hours of daylight. It is the 8th-warmest and 9th-wettest month of the year here.

Highs climb over the month, from about 5°C in the first days to 10°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 19% of the time in March,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 10 h 36 min at the start of March to 12 h 30 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, March is Bardejov's 8th-clearest and 1st-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Bardejov's year-round climate.

Temperature in March

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Highs climb over the month, from about 5°C in the first days to 10°C by the end.

A typical March day in Bardejov reaches about 7°C in the afternoon and slips back to -1°C overnight — a 8°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 1°C and 14°C. Set against its neighbours, March runs about 5°C warmer than February and about 6°C cooler than April.

Sunrise & sunset in March

DaylightNight

Daylight runs from about 10 h 36 min at the start of March to 12 h 30 min by month's end. The lit band spans sunrise to sunset each day.

Days grow by about 114 minutes over March. Sunrise moves from 6:29 AM to 5:25 AM, and sunset from 5:07 PM to 5:54 PM.

Location & terrain

Where is Bardejov?

Bardejov sits at 49.3°N, 21.3°E, 283 m above sea level, in Slovakia. The nearest listed city is Prešov, 33 km away.

Topography around Bardejov

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Bardejov.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Bardejov has signific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 319 m around an average of 349 m above sea level; within 16 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 898 m; within 80 km, extreme vari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 2,441 m.

The land around Bardejov is covered by trees (52%) within 3 km, trees (62%) and cropland (22%) within 16 km, and trees (64%) and cropland (20%) within 80 km.
